On an unrelated note I decided to do some tire testing.
I've heard that the tires in GT5 degrade at the same rate (IE a Racing Hard and a Racing Soft will only do the same # of laps).

So I decided to test this by doing donuts in a high powered car.
The Racing Softs and Mediums both ran out at exactly 1min 9secs
The Racing Hard however ran out at exactly 1min 15secs
I was able to repeat all results... so maybe there is something to the racing hard having "slightly" more life than a soft/medium tire.

Now in the test above I burned them until there was nothing left. I didn't test for the "let go" factor, which generally happens at 2/3 to 50% of tread left. We all know the higher hp cars are undriveable with anything under 1/3 of the tread left.
